Advantages and disadvantages of the cellular method

The undoubted advantage of breeding rabbits in cages is complete control over the state and vital activity of each individual at any time.

With cellular content, feed is used most rationally. Care is individual, taking into account the peculiarities of temperament. This allows you to conduct high-quality breeding selection. Animals are isolated from each other, which reduces the risk of epidemics.

The main disadvantage of cell content is the need for quite tangible costs for the acquisition (or manufacture) of cells, the laboriousness of the process.

Aviary Requirements

To protect against "external enemies" and to prevent "escapes" rabbits should be securely isolated. Along the perimeter, the enclosure is usually fenced with a metal mesh, but any material that will not be gnawed by rabbits will do. Free animals willingly dig holes, so it is necessary to deepen the fence by at least 0.8 meters.
